Is Betz Mystery Sphere Real?
Evidence, debunks, and current assessment for Betz Mystery Sphere / 贝茨神秘球.
Direct Answer
The sphere and its media history are well documented, but extraordinary behavior and origin claims rely on fragmented secondary accounts and face a plausible industrial-object explanation.

Most Likely Explanation
The strongest current reading favors conventional explanations for the extraordinary claim, while preserving the documented event record.
Remaining Questions
- Where are the strongest original 1974 newspaper clippings and Navy records?
- Can the sphere's exact custody and test history be reconstructed from primary documents?
- Was a matching industrial component documented near Jacksonville at the time?
FAQ
Was the Betz Sphere real?
Yes, the case concerns a real metal sphere reported by the Betz family, but the extraordinary interpretation is not established.
Is it likely alien technology?
Current attached sources favor a manufactured object explanation over an extraterrestrial origin.
